Phoenix junkyard catches on fire
Fire crews in Phoenix battled a fire at a junkyard near 27th Avenue and Broadway Road that sent a large plume of smoke into the air on the afternoon of Dec. 18.
PHOENIX – Phoenix firefighters battled a junkyard fire on Thursday night that burned dozens of cars.
What we know:
The Dec. 18 fire broke out just before 5 p.m. near 27th Avenue and Broadway Road.
About 30 cars were on fire when firefighters arrived, Phoenix Fire Capt. DJ Lee said.
He adds, “Firefighters quickly secured a water supply and took multiple handlines in to fight the blaze. The fire was balanced to a first alarm due to the size of the yard and the amount of cars on fire.”
No injuries were reported.
What we don’t know:
The cause of the fire is under investigation.
